Motivated by the option of going on blood pressure medicine in 2014, Carl decided it was time to take his health into his own hands. The doctor informed Carl that he must lose weight to decrease his risks of a heart attack. At that time, Carl weighed 440 pounds. After making a life-change by instituting one hour of walking every day and changing his eating habits on the road, he has successfully lost over 130 pounds since that early diagnosis of obesity and high blood pressure.

A few years ago, Melvin realized that he needed to take some steps to improve his health while he was on the road.  Driving involves a lot of "sitting time" throughout the week.  Many times, you do not feel like exercising on your time off or at home.  Melvin knew that he needed to take some time to improve himself physically while he was in the truck.  So a few years ago, he began doing a system of simple exercises while inside the truck on breaks.
